Patent number: 8049407Abstract: The present invention provides an organic electroluminescent element that includes a pair of electrodes and a plurality of organic compound layers being disposed between the pair of electrodes. The organic compound layers include a luminescent layer containing a blue phosphorescent luminescent material and a host material having the lowest excited triplet energy (T1) of 272 kJ/mol (65 kcal/mol) or more, and hole transport layers. One of the hole transport layers is a layer adjacent to the luminescent layer, and when the ionization potentials of the luminescent layer, the hole transport layer adjacent to the luminescent layer, and another of the hole transport layers, respectively, designated to Ip1, Ip2 and Ip3, the relationship Ip1>Ip2>Ip3 is satisfied.Type: GrantFiled: September 14, 2005Date of Patent: November 1, 2011Assignee: Fujifilm CorporationInventors: Jiro Tsukahara, Tatsuya Igarashi, Toshihiro Ise, Yoshitaka Kitamura

Patent number: 8049398Abstract: A long-life high-pressure discharge lamp can (i) suppress damage to sealing portions, especially at an initial stage of the accumulated lighting time, (ii) allow for easy assembly of components such as electrodes and (iii) prevent deformation/ripping of metallic foils. An arc tube is a glass enveloping vessel with electrodes arranged therein, and includes: a light emitting portion in which materials are enclosed and a discharge space is formed; and sealing portions provided at ends of the light emitting portion. Each electrode includes an electrode bar whose first end is in the discharge space, and whose second end is in the corresponding sealing portion and connected to a metallic foil. The second end of each electrode bar is partially wrapped around by a sleeve-like metallic cover foil that has a cut-out section positioned over a joining area where the second end of each electrode bar is joined to the metallic foil.Type: GrantFiled: September 16, 2008Date of Patent: November 1, 2011Assignee: Panasonic CorporationInventors: Yoshiki Kitahara, Katsuhiro Ono, Jun Sakaguchi

Patent number: 8040065Abstract: An electric lamp is described, which has a quartz glass lamp vessel (10) accommodating an electric element (3, 4). The lamp vessel locally has a light-absorbing, non-reflective coating (11, 12). The coating mainly consists of iron, iron oxide, silicon, and silicon dioxide, the ratio of the weight percentages of iron (compounds) and silicon (compounds) being in the range of 0.17<=iron (compounds)/silicon (compounds)<-12, and the ratio of the weight percentages of silicon and silicon dioxide being in the range of 0.5<=silicon/silicon dioxide<=50.Type: GrantFiled: November 6, 2007Date of Patent: October 18, 2011Assignee: Koninklijke Philips Electronics N.V.Inventor: Heinz Josef Schloemer

Patent number: 8035293Abstract: A light emitting device has an enclosure with a face portion, a cold cathode within the enclosure, a phosphor layer disposed on an interior surface of the face portion, an extracting grid between the cold cathode and the phosphor layer and a defocusing grid between the extracting grid and the phosphor layer. Electrons emitted from the cold cathode are defocused by the defocusing grid and impact the phosphor layer when an electric field is created between the cold cathode and the phosphor layer due to applied voltages at the cold cathode, extracting grid, defocusing grid and phosphor layer. The phosphor layer emits light through the face portion in response to electrons incident thereon. Secondary electron emission may also occur resulting in increased electron impact upon the phosphor layer, thereby increasing light output. A mirror layer may be included to reflect light toward the face portion of the light emitting device.Type: GrantFiled: December 16, 2005Date of Patent: October 11, 2011Assignee: Vu1 CorporationInventor: Stalimir Popovich

Patent number: 8004170Abstract: A low pressure fluorescent tanning lamp (10) includes an elongated, tubular glass envelope (12) including an arc generating and sustaining medium (14) and electrodes (16) therewithin and having a first section (18) and a second section (20). A phosphor coating (22) is provided on the interior of the first section (18) and only a portion (24) of the second section (20). The phosphor coating comprises materials emitting in the UVA and UVB areas of the electromagnetic spectrum and additionally in the visible area of the electromagnetic spectrum in the range above 600 nm. The second section (20) includes a clear window (26) and the phosphor comprises a mixture comprising about 91% BaSi2O5:Pb; about 6% MgSrAl10O17:Ce; and about 3% Y2O3:Eu.Type: GrantFiled: August 28, 2008Date of Patent: August 23, 2011Inventors: Steven C.
